In the state of Quintana Rooa few kilometers from La Laguna de Bacalar, the Maya raised an older city than others as famous as the aforementioned Chichen Itzá. HE esteem That it began to populate at some point in 400 BC and was inhabited until 1500 AD was the most important administrative city of the Maya, something that is believed due to the imposing size of some of its constructions. The problem is that, for centuries, the area was totally forgotten by the nature of nature, whose green opulence swallowed practically every trace of the buildings of the Maya except the main temple and some more construction. And, as is usually the case, its discovery was almost by accident. Fluke. In 1995, a team of researchers from the National Institute of Anthropology and History was in the area searching A much smaller archaeological territory known as ‘Las Higueras’ when they ran into something different and much larger. Thus, they ran into an imposing pyramid, but also with mounds of land and vegetation that covered different buildings. They immediately realized the importance of the site, so a path was built that can be seen perfectly in Apps such as Google Earth –This link-. In addition, in the application we can understand how the site had gone totally unnoticed due to that vegetation. The Mesoamerican Egypt. But well, there was no doubt that they were facing something big. In Ichkabal, the Maya built several small and medium buildings, but also other colossal. For example, an open square of about 300 meters, a couple of small pyramids and the crown jewel: a building 46 meters high and a 200 -meter plant. There is also a 60 x 8 -meter lagoon that could have supplied the population. And that proximity to a source of water and the ocean itself is what could have given Ichkabal the administrative importance that is estimated, had. Due to the size of these constructions, the Mesoamerican Egypt ‘has been called to the area. Rivaling with Kukulcán. To get an idea of ​​the size of that construction, the Kukulcán Temple that is the main Mayan attraction of Mexico as part of Chichén Itzá and indisputable protagonist of the equinox Spring and autumn, it has a height of about 30 meters and a base of 55.5 meters. The base of the main building of Ichkabal is four times larger and the height reaches 15 meters more. Founded in Denmark in 1932Lego began to manufacture plastic bricks in 1949. Over time, he expanded his catalog and consolidated himself as one of the most influential toy brands in the world, although without paying attention to the digital world. However, at the beginning of the 1990s, when computer science began to collect more strength than ever, a group of enthusiasts led by the artist Dent-de-lion du Midi (also known as dandi) thought it was the moment that LEGO would make the leap from the physical world to the films and, eventually, that of video games. Lego in the world of video games To convince the company was not an easy task. Dandi and his team worked for more than a year in the creation of a digital library that recreated Lego bricks in a virtual environment, an idea that was revolutionary at that time. But when they finally presented the project, The answer was a blunt not. Despite the rejection, the team did not give up. Instead of leaving the initiative, they decided to bring their proposal directly to Kjeld Kirk Kristiansen, CEO of the company and grandson of the founder. The bet went well. Kristiansen was impressed enough to assign a budget for an in -depth study on the digitalization of Lego products. That study would end up paying fruits. With an initial investment of 11.5 million dollars (about 27 million adjusted to inflation), the “was born”Darwin Project“, an initiative that gave rise to four divisions, one of them dedicated to video games. From here, ‘Lego Island’ in 1997, the first video game for the company’s PC was helped. However, the initial enthusiasm did not take long to be eclipsed by the financial reality of the company. In the early 2000s, in full economic crisis, Lego decided to sell its division of video games as part of a strategy of a strategy Restructuring to avoid bankruptcy, thus delegating the development of their titles in external studies. Today, the situation is radically different. LEGO has not only avoided bankrupt Billing of 10,100 million dollars in 202413% more than the previous year. With its business more solid than ever, the company has decided to recover control over its digital strategy. “We can cover experiences for children of all ages, digital or physical,” says Christiansen. For that purpose, an internal game development division “It is something we are building” The bet is firm. LEGO has invested hundreds of millions of dollars to triple its template of software engineers since 2022 and in reinforcing its digital infrastructure. A new study He has found evidence that people who live in the vicinity of Huelva industrial areas accumulate in their bodies amounts higher than the average heavy metals such as those we usually associate with industrial activity. The study observed that among the inhabitants of the region, the accumulation in the body of certain elements was greater than usual. The study was done In the city of Huelvabut it was observed that the pollutants varied depending on the residence area of ​​the participants. Different concentrations. Among those who lived in areas closer to the rafts of phosphoyesos From the region, the study found a greater presence of elements such as arsenic (as), lead (PB), cadmium (CD), molybdenum (mo) and selenium (se). These types of elements can be found, precisely in places where this type of waste is stored. On the other hand, the team also found areas that stood out for the presence of elements such as copper (cu), zinc (zn) and aluminum (al). These areas were the closest to the industrial area of ​​the region. In general, the inhabitants of the city of Huelva presented greater concentrations of iron (faith), nickel (ni), chromium (cr), selenium (se), arsenic (as), and copper (co) according to the results of the study. The “chemical and industrial pole. The study was conducted in the city of Huelva, a city located near the coast, between the confluence of the red and odiel rivers. The city counts around, explains the team responsible for the study, with three important industrial areas. First, phosphoyesos rafts can be found, an industrial residue resulting from the extraction and processing of phosphoric acid. This residue is categorized as a radioactive material that occurred naturally or norm (Naturally Occurring Radioactive Material) and the Huelva reserve is the largest in Europe, the team recalls. To this we must add two more conventional industrial areas, the “Chemical Pole for the Promotion and Development of Huelva – Punta del Sebo” and the “Nuevo Puerto Palos de la Frontera”. Both areas also located in the vicinity of the capital (being the first adjacent to it). 55 participants. The study was conducted with a little girl from participants residing in the capital. Samples extracted from the feet nails of these to estimate the concentration in the bodies of a series of elements: aluminum (al), arsenic (as), cadmium (CD), copper (cu), chrome (cr), iron (faith), nickel (ni), Uranium (U), Vanadio (V) and Zinc (Zn), among others. Ruthenium is making its way in the integrated circuit industry Before we investigate the properties of Ruthenium, it is good for us to know precisely what the chips manufacturers use the copper. And they use it first of all in the connections of the transistors within the integrated circuits. Copper links are responsible for transmitting electrical signals between some transistors and others, so their intervention is essential within the semiconductors. In fact, the electrical properties that I have highlighted in the previous paragraph are responsible for this metal having such a relevant role. However, its adoption was initially not simple. And it was not because copper can be filtered in silicon. This process is known as the diffusion of copper in silicon, and is similar to the electromigration of which We talk to you in this other article To explain why this last phenomenon represents a threat to our electronic devices. In any case, during the diffusion the copper atoms move and infiltrate the crystalline structure of the silicon, degrading it and conditioning its physicochemical properties. “Now I think the industry is probably considering ruthenium as the next great advance in interconnections beyond copper.” Fortunately, IBM found the solution to this problem in 1998. His researchers realized that it was possible copper infiltrate silicon. This strategy was so effective that the semiconductor industry adopted it and has maintained it so far. However, innovation makes its way, and Ruthenium, as I mentioned a few lines above, seems to be called to replace copper in connections between transistors. Jon Yu, the person in charge of the Newsletter The Asianometryhe has suggested very rightly During the conversation who has maintained with Ben Thompson, the author of the interesting publication Stratechery. “The entire industry followed the steps of IBM And copper had to be treated in an innovative way that has worked well for more than 20 years. Now I believe that the industry is probably considering ruthenium as the next great advance in interconnections beyond copper. “ Like copper, Ruthenium is a transition metal. The two properties that make it so interesting to occupy the place of copper within the integrated circuits are its high electrical conductivity and its excellent corrosion resistance. However, we cannot overlook something very important: Ruthenium is very scarce in the earth’s crust. Very scarce. Only 0.0000002% of the cortex of our planet is Ruthenium. The main reserves of this metal are found in South Africa, Russia, Zimbabue, Canada and the US. Now, the US agency in charge of regulating drugs in the country, the FDA (Food and Drug Administration), announced yesterday the approval of A new drug In the country. It is an analgesic not opioid, the first to reach the US in decades. We still have information about its hypothetical arrival in Europe. The drug is focused on the treatment of pain between moderate and severe in adult patients, according to explained in a press release the agency responsible for its approval. A curious detail indicated by the agency is that those who undergo this treatment must avoid grapefruit, something relatively common With certain treatments. “Approval (…) is an important achievement in public health in acute pain management,” indicated in the same note Jacqueline Corrigan-Curay, Director of the Center for the Evaluation and Research of Medicines of the FDA. “A new therapeutic class of non -opioid analgesics for acute pain offers an opportunity to mitigate certain risks associated with the use of opioids (…) and provides patients with another option.” Suzetrigine This is suzetrigine (Suzetrigine), which will be marketed in 50 mg pills for oral administration under the name Journavx. The new drug has been developed by the company Vertex Pharmaceuticals. It is administered in several doses: an initial of 100 mg and successive doses of 50 mg every 12 hours, dosage calculated through the clinical trials that gave rise to their approval. Essays that also indicated that, even though an effective compound, the new analgesic has a moderate pain reduction effect. “It is not a mate in effectiveness,” explained in statements collected by AP Michael Schuh, from the Mayo Clinic, who was not involved in the development of the drug. “But it is a mate in the fact that it is a very different route and mechanism of action. That’s why I think it shows a great promise. ” How do you know where it hurts? Suzetrigine works in our body focusing on sodium channels which exercise as a way in the pain signaling system of the peripheral nervous system. This is a different route from that used by other analgesics such as opioids, which act in the area of ​​the brain that processes pain. The new drug hinders the arrival of the signal to the brain. More than a quarter of a century later. According to Explain the US chain CNNthis is the first analgesic approved since 1998, the year in which the agency approved Celebrex (Celecoxib), an anti-inflammatory non-steroid inhibitor of the COX-2, an enzyme responsible for accelerating the formation of substances that cause in our body inflammation and pain. Investor interest. Waiting for stock markets to open in the US, everything seems to indicate that approval will imply the recovery of the company’s market value In December last year After a bad provisional results of closing of the year. The stock market contribution of the company was gradually recovering throughout January and the announcement could confirm the “return to normal” in the figures of the company on the stock market. An epidemic. In the US, analgesics are the type of drug More prescribed in hospitals And among them it is the opioids that represent almost half of the pain recipes. The epidemic is a consequence of a multitude of factors and has as the protagonist the fentanil, a synthetic opioid approved for pharmacological use but whose use as recreational drugs ravages in North America. By using different mechanisms that opioids and not generating sensations of euphoria, excitement or similar, experts believe that it will not generate dependence or addiction. This could help reduce the impact of the crisis if we take into account that the dependence on opioids in numerous cases began with its pharmacological and non -recreational use. On July 24, 2015, the Council of Ministers He approved to give him 35 million euros to the Guadalquivir Hydrographic Confederation to buy a farm. Very few intuited it a decade ago, but on that farm was a good part of Doñana’s future. We are about to see it come true. A farm? What farm? The Cortijo de los Mimbral were 1,061 hectares in the Doñana forest crown. Of these, about 968 hectares They were dedicated to the cultivation of orange and the rest were “structures, warehouses, roads interior mobility and boundaries, rafts, etc.”. That 2015, the government bought 922 of them. And he did it with the idea of Recover a water concession. That is, with the idea of ​​reducing by 6.8 hm3 the annual water extractions of the Almonte and Las Marismas aquifer. And it was done. With some controversy with the surroundings of the environment, the closure of the mimbrals was good news for the conservation of the park. And, eye, it is not an area of ​​Spain in which good news abounds. But, beyond that and in practice, the farm had been abandoned for years. Now it’s time to see what we do with her. Because the mimbrals are, above all, an opportunity. We must not lose sight that we talk about a thousand hectares that, for years, underwent quite intensive agricultural processes that denatured their traditional state. The great question of Doñana’s technicians has always been the same,?can go back? Can we restore paradise? That, According to Minister Aagesenit is what is going to try. The great laboratory to recover Spain. To begin with, the General Directorate wants to renaturalize the two channels that cross the farm and seal the drainage channels. Thus, they hope to recover the lagoon and riverside habitats. To do this, they will recover native plant species (and eliminate eucalyptus, acacias or reeds); And they wait Reintroduce the rabbit which is “a fundamental element in Doñana’s trophic chain.” They are just five million euros, but they aspire to be a key piece of a 1,400 million program for the entire park environment.
